FL Studio is fully professional DAW. Included native VSTs are very good (for example producer edition contains Sytrus which is one of the best FM synths on market with some unique features). The workflow is very fast once you get hang of it. This DAW despite of what people over interent sometimes say is capable of doing all the things which other DAWs like Cubase, Pro Tools, Logic, Ableton can do. And on top of that you get life time free upgrades which made me chose it and i feel like i will never regret chosing this workstation!

This one is my main go to library for every heavy orchestral compositions. The main purpose of this library is to serve as a Epic/Trailer music all rounder but you can use it to write fortissimo possible sections in any orchestral score. There are lots of articulations to chose from for every instrument. Legato patches are amazing. Included Choir is something that i instantly loved. Horn sections are huge and full. Bass instruments sounds very good and agressive. Strings are also unique and fits the whole kit. I also like all the percussion and hits. Overall the only missing element in this library are woodwinds but looking at agressive and heavy approach on the dynamic range of instruments in this library its completely understandable (just use different library for woods). This syhthesizer is sounding unique and full. I chosed it over Serum even tho i was aware that Serum has higher sound design potential the warm and clean sound of Spire made me to go with it. Spire filters are amazing in my opinion and you have several choices in this regard (for example virus ti emulation, TB-303 emulation, comb and others). The effects are not bad and i often use them along with external ones. I like the x-comp section which is a good way to add quick multiband compression on your designed sound. The oscillators give you really a lot of possibilities to shape the sound. Its not possible to inject custom wavetables like in Serum but you can chose from included ones and with possibility to FM and hard FM you can get some really interesting sound design patches. This synthesizer is great for Leads, agressive Basslines and lush pads. I recommend it definitely.
